ORDER
Seeking to review the order passed in W.P.No.30261 of 2013 dated 12.06.2014, the present application has been filed. 2.
By the order aforesaid dated 12.06.2014, the writ petition was dismissed in the following manner.
"4. The learned Additional Government Pleader further submitted that the second respondent, in and by order dated 18.07.2012, ordered change of location of hostel and the decision of the second respondent has also been accepted by the first respondent and the decision taken, being an administrative one based upon relevant materials, no interference is warranted.
5.As rightly submitted by the learned Additional Government Pleader, the petitioner does not have any vested right to insist that the school hostel, as existing now, should be allowed to continue. The respondents have taken into consideration, all relevant materials. When such an administrative decision is taken, the power of judicial review over the same shall not be exercised. The decision taken by the second respondent has also not been challenged before this Court."
3.
The only submission made by the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ner is that the Honourable Chief Minister of the Tamil Nadu, on the floor of the assembly, made an announcement on 09.05.2013 for the construction of the new hostel buildings for 68 hostels including the boys hostel at Vennampalli Village, Krishnagiri District. Thus, considering the aforesaid statement, the order requires review.
4.
We are afraid that the said contention cannot be the basis to review the order passed. A mere statement, if any, per se would not create a right in favour of the petitioner seeking a writ of mandamus. Thus, the review application stands dismissed. However, it is made clear that the dismissal of the writ petition and the review application will not stand in the way of the respondents from taking any subsequent decision as per law.
